The thick-fleshed fruits, around 7 cm long, impress with their pleasantly spicy flavour and characteristic corky cracks – a sign of the very best quality. As they ripen, the jalapeños change colour from green to a vibrant red, making them a highlight not only in terms of flavour but also visually.
For successful cultivation, it’s best to sow the seeds in trays between February and April. Maintain a germination temperature of 25–30 °C to achieve optimal results. Once the seedlings are strong enough, transplant them outdoors or into larger pots from May to June. The harvest season runs from July to October – so you can enjoy fresh jalapeños for many weeks.
